Runnin’ Bulldogs Fall to Charlotte in Straight Sets Thursday Afternoon
September 06, 2018 | Volleyball
GREENVILLE, N.C. – Gardner-Webb fell to Charlotte, 3-0, in the opening match of the 2018 Pirate Invitational, hosted by East Carolina at Minges Coliseum in Greenville, N.C.
Gardner-Webb (3-4) dropped the first set to Charlotte (6-4) by a 25-21 score, and the 49ers would take the remaining sets by scores of 25-15 and 25-23.
The Runnin' Bulldogs had 30 kills on 92 attempts for a .141 attack percentage, while Charlotte tallied 39 kills on 88 swings for a .307 attacking percentage.
"This was not our best effort today," stated GWU head coach Leo Sayles. "We struggled offensively early, and we did not adapt to the conditions or the situations presented to us. I credit Maya Jeffcoat-Troy and Alexandria Roycraft for giving us a solid lift off of the bench, which shows our depth. I think our players are very focused on redeeming themselves tomorrow."
Maria Emmick was the leading attacker for GWU, collecting nine kills on 22 swings. Amanda Sahm had team-best 13 assists on the day. Charissa Coleman had 11 digs to lead the 'Dogs, while Emmick also had a solo block.
Molly Shaw led the Charlotte attack with 10 smashes on 28 attempts. Nya Steele had a match-high 32 assists, while Yumi Garcia collected 18 digs and Jocelyn Stoner had one solo block and two block assists to lead the 49ers.
Gardner-Webb returns to action tomorrow at noon to take on tournament host East Carolina as the 2018 Pirate Invitational continues.
